I thank my colleague from New Hampshire. For millions of American women, reading the news this morning was like stepping into a time machine and going back 50 years, seeing the headlines and the photos of this all-male panel in the House talking about a woman's right to access birth control, and no women on the panel. It turns out the chairman of the House oversight committee decided he was not going to allow a young woman who had been asked by the minority to testify and tell her story--actually of a friend who had lost an ovary because of her lack of contraception coverage. So this 19-year-old woman was left to watch, like the rest of us, as all five men addressed the committee about how they supported efforts to restrict access to care. I am sure by now many of my colleagues here have seen this picture of this all-male panel, the picture that says a thousand words. It is one that most women thought was left behind when pictures only came in black and white. But this was not the only story this morning that made women feel as if the clock had been turned back on them. The other story comes to us from the Republican Presidential nomination trail. It seems that yesterday, on national television, one of the chief financial backers for Rick Santorum, the Republican candidate who is now surging toward the nomination, suggested that contraception was once as simple as a woman putting aspirin between her knees. Really? Shocking. Appalling. An insult.…
